Global Horror Film and TV Show Market Poised for Robust Growth

The Horror Film and TV Show Market is witnessing a surge in popularity, fueled by evolving audience preferences and expanding digital platforms. Horror as a genre captivates viewers with its unique blend of suspense, fear, and thrill, maintaining a steady demand worldwide across both films and television series.

Driven by the proliferation of streaming services and the rise of interactive content, the market is undergoing significant transformation. Diverse content formats and innovative storytelling approaches are attracting a wider audience base globally. The increasing influence of social media and fan communities further stimulates engagement with horror productions.

Recent forecasts suggest that the global horror film and TV show market will gr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 8.1% over the next five years, highlighting its lucrative potential.

Market Drivers: What’s Fueling Demand?

  • Expanding Digital Platforms: Streaming giants are investing heavily in original horror content to attract subscribers.

  • Audience Appetite for Thrills: The human fascination with fear and adrenaline sustains interest in horror narratives.

  • Technological Advancements: Improved special effects and immersive technologies enhance viewer experience.

The global reach of horror content, supported by translations and dubbing, has opened new markets, making horror films and TV shows accessible to diverse linguistic audiences.

Market Restraints: Challenges Impacting Growth

Despite strong demand, several factors limit growth:

  • Content Saturation: Overproduction may lead to viewer fatigue and declining interest.

  • Censorship and Regulation: Strict content guidelines in some regions restrict the availability of graphic horror content.

  • Cultural Differences: Varied acceptance of horror themes limits universal appeal in certain countries.

Addressing these challenges requires careful content curation and compliance with local regulations.

Market Opportunities: New Horizons

  • Virtual Reality (VR) Integration: VR horror experiences offer immersive entertainment, opening innovative avenues.

  • Global Collaborations: Co-productions between countries can fuse diverse horror styles and expand audience reach.

  • Merchandising and Licensing: Expanding into themed merchandise and games supplements revenue streams.

Growing fan conventions and horror festivals worldwide also create promotional opportunities for market players.

Market Dynamics and Statistical Insights

The horror film and TV show market is shaped by fluctuating consumer preferences and technological progress. Notable statistics include:

  • North America leads in market share due to established entertainment industries and high consumer spending.

  • The Asia-Pacific region is the fastest-growing market, driven by increasing internet penetration and digital content consumption.

  • Europe maintains steady growth, supported by diverse cultural narratives and film festivals focusing on horror genres.

Consumer Behavior and Content Trends

Horror audiences display a growing preference for sub-genres like psychological thrillers, supernatural horror, and slasher films. Series with deep story arcs on streaming platforms tend to generate higher viewer retention than standalone movies.

Content creators increasingly use data analytics to tailor horror narratives that resonate with target demographics, enhancing engagement and market performance.

Distribution Channels and Market Segmentation

The horror market segments include:

  • Format: Films vs. TV shows/series.

  • Platform: Theatrical releases, television networks, and OTT (Over-the-Top) streaming services.

  • Geography: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East & Africa.

OTT platforms continue to dominate due to ease of access and the ability to offer on-demand horror content globally.
